Output efac07f8a788f391d301d25a0900b12da03977edd6bd24b3bdf7694b52891db2:0

value
50679000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4c904783a82b29f92ad525dfb4211ddd8f2baba OP_EQUAL
address
3JAvN1br5Fwc35TDtb4zFK79Tfqh7yGsnY
transaction
efac07f8a788f391d301d25a0900b12da03977edd6bd24b3bdf7694b52891db2
spent
true